Leg cramps are sudden, involuntary muscle contractions in the legs that can be sharp, painful, and disruptive. From a physical standpoint, they’re often linked to dehydration, electrolyte imbalances (such as low potassium, magnesium, or calcium), muscle fatigue, poor circulation, long periods of sitting or standing, certain medications, pregnancy, or underlying health conditions like diabetes or nerve issues. Simple remedies—stretching the muscle, hydrating, gently massaging the area, or applying warmth—can usually bring quick relief. Preventively, staying hydrated, maintaining balanced nutrition, stretching regularly, and avoiding prolonged strain on the legs can reduce how often cramps occur.
